内核源码:linux2.6.30.4

交叉编译工具:3.4.5

移植linux内核至:TQ2440

工作基础:http://www.cnblogs.com/nufangrensheng/p/3669623.html

一、下载yaffs2源码

二、进入yaffs2目录,执行打补丁脚本文件patch-ker.sh,打补丁到内核中:

cd yaffs2

./patch-ker.sh c …/linux2.6.30.4

三、在内核配置中添加对yaffs的支持

执行make menuconfig进入配置单,具体配置如下:

linux2.6.30.4内核移植(3)——yaffs文件系统移植

linux2.6.30.4内核移植(3)——yaffs文件系统移植

其他配置使用默认值。

保存退出,编译镜像即可。烧写镜像文件到开发板,启动后可看到yaffs的安装信息:

linux2.6.30.4内核移植(3)——yaffs文件系统移植

这样内核就支持YAFFS文件系统了。另外,内核原来已经支持JFFS2文件系统。

相关文章:

  • 2022-01-19
  • 2022-12-23
  • 2021-08-10
  • 2021-05-15
  • 2021-07-01
  • 2021-06-28
  • 2021-09-02
  • 2021-12-05
猜你喜欢
  • 2022-12-23
  • 2021-05-29
  • 2021-08-12
  • 2021-10-08
  • 2021-11-02
  • 2021-10-21
  • 2021-11-26
相关资源
相似解决方案